On Monday 19 February 2007 02:47, Hans-Stefan Bauer wrote:
> storm1 hsbauer # /etc/init.d/gfs start
>  * Starting gfs cluster:
>  * Loading lock_dlm kernel module ...
> FATAL: Error inserting lock_dlm (/fs/gfs_locking/lock_dlm/lock_dlm.ko):
> Unknown symbol in module, or unknown parameter (see dmesg)
>  * Failed to load lock_dlm kernel
> module                                   [ !! ]

Check your kernel configuration, particularly the "Distributed Lock 
Manager" 
option, CONFIG_DLM.  You may need that part of mainline so that your 
out-of-tree module works.

> Apart from the occurring problem it is strange for me that emerge
> installs the kernel module into the root directory of the system (see
> error message above) and not into "/lib/modules/..." as I would expect.

Hrm, double-check (by looking at your filesystem) to make sure it's in the 
wrong place.  If so, please file a bug, that behavior is broken.
